Azzam - Name Meaning, Origin & Popularity

Spelling of Azzam
A-Z-Z-A-M, is a 5-letter male given name.
Pronunciation of Azzam
ah-ZAHM
Meaning of Azzam
Determined, resolute or persevering, resolved.
Origin of Azzam
The name 'Azzam' is a male name with roots in Arabic, meaning 'determined' or 'resolute'. Etymology of Azzam

The etymology of the name 'Azzam' can be traced back to the Arabic word 'azama', which means 'to be determined' or 'to be resolute'. This linguistic root reflects the core meaning and essence of the name, emphasizing the qualities of determination and steadfastness.
